Quote: Originally written by FFX2000: History's great and all, but heck, a whole lot of it's boring.(although the history of Exile/Avernum wouldn't be, I'm sure, but the Empire, God thats like, horrible, especialy what they did, why the heck would anyone want any more horrible facts about how they treated people?) Hmmm....but that's the point. Because there's no written history of Ermarian by Jeff/anyone else, how do we know what the Empire used to be like? Perhaps at one stage it was a golden kingdom of fluffy bunnies and abundant riches for all. Or perhaps it was always a despotic, explotative empire up to the time of Hawthorne (Prazac was a bit better, I think you'll agree). Without history we don't know. And finally, remember: those who ignore history are doomed to repeat it. Edit: Also, as has been said on the American Conflict Avatars (or whatever it's called) board, empires and countries go through good times and bad times. I suspect that the Ermarian Empire would be the same.
